Output 89ce77a90f2138af63d8bd030b3a6a3402b4256b57911b725119406975e10619:0

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de37dbcb51f0145a5d3617d6da584b5021e3f0aa OP_EQUALVERIFY OP_CHECKSIG
address
1MFyvi4SQQahDv41RH3r7nMbqYieajThAr
transaction
89ce77a90f2138af63d8bd030b3a6a3402b4256b57911b725119406975e10619
spent
true